Finding affordable Outside School Hours Care (OSHC) is a priority for many families. The Child Care Subsidy (CCS) helps reduce the cost of Before & After School Care and School Holiday Programs (vacation care), making it more accessible for eligible families.
In this guide, we’ll explain how CCS works for OSHC, including the new 3-Day Guarantee, how much you could save, and what other financial support is available.
Does the Child Care Subsidy (CCS) cover Before & After School Care and Vacation Care services?
Yes! If your child attends an approved OSHC service, including Before & After School Care or School Holiday Programs, your family may be eligible for the Child Care Subsidy (CCS) to help lower your fees.
Am I eligible for CCS?
To receive CCS for OSHC, your family must meet the following criteria:
Your child is enrolled in an approved OSHC service
Your family meets the residency requirements, which generally means you or your partner are an Australian citizen, a permanent resident, or hold an eligible visa.
Your family meets the income requirements
Your child meets immunisation requirements
You are the person responsible for paying the OSHC fees
How much CCS can I get?
Your combined family income: Determines the percentage of OSHC fees covered by CCS.
Your approved activity level: The number of hours you work, study, volunteer, or look for work affects how many subsidised hours you can access each fortnight. Under the 3-Day Guarantee, all eligible families receive at least 72 subsidised hours per child per fortnight, regardless of activity levels. Under certain circumstances, families can get 100 hours of subsidised care each fortnight.
The hourly rate cap: The government sets a maximum hourly amount it will subsidise for each type of care.

How do I apply for CCS?
Sign in to MyGov and link your account to Centrelink.
Submit a CCS claim with your child’s details and OSHC provider information.
Provide supporting documents as required.
Once approved, CCS is paid directly to your OSHC provider, reducing the amount you need to pay.
Can I get CCS information in my language?
CCS information is available in multiple languages through Services Australia.
